Sitting in Richmond at the first of two deliveries. Both places are less than 5 miles from the yard. Last night was exciting. I was at the Loves off 85 north of Spartanburg, SC. I noticed beside me an old beat up Freightliner pulling a beat up reefer. A hispanic gentleman sitting in the drivers having animated talks in Spanish on his phone. Thought nothing of it until 2 black Tahoes pull up and out comes a K9. Driver detained, k9 alerts. DEA shows up, like 6 undercover cars, VOILA!!!! 6 kilos of cocaine came out of the reefers housing. Watched them test it and of course I was eavesdropping. Drivers were calling me on the CB asking for the play by play. It was right next to me. A couple hours of searching and etc later a DEA guys climbs in and drove off in the rig. I guess they will tear it to pieces! Overheard "...fake DOT number..."
All in all a pretty cool night!5speed, YardDart and Weeble Kneeble Thank this. -

Got to the yard about 1530 yesterday and fueled up. Still hadnt got a new load and I stayed hooked to my empty dry van in case I was headed to LL. Called Brett and got a load of brake pads going to Kutztown, PA. Drove OD to Pilot showered and ate back to yard. Hooked the trailer and ran it across the scales. Tandems all the way to the rear and 36000. Had Marlon unload and reload entire trailer. Ran it across and it was fixed. One problem though! I didnt total the wts the first time but I did the 2nd time. 80600. Told dispatch and pull me off it! Chris comes out to truck and tells me to go to the shop they are going to siphon 100 gal of fuel out of my tanks!!Can you believe that crap!?!? So I called Scott to CYA myself. He said stupid and him and Allen smacked some peabrains around. End result I was removed from the load and Chris dumped it in Bo's lap to deal with. Still sitting here with no load as of now...i have hometime starting tomorrow night. Just may logout and go home now!!!
